Nyanko Rock
Nyanko Rock is a dive site reached by a short boat ride, with the option to swim out in about 25 minutes for experienced, adventurous divers. It is commonly used as an early stop in the day because of its relatively deeper profile and quick drop-offs. The site is used for deep-diving and training courses, with depths reported down to 40 m. Marine life includes a variety of fish, with jawfish especially abundant; catsharks are said to be more common in cooler months.
